estructura PEP_PPM_QUERY_FEEDBACK_COUNTERS (pepfx.h)

La estructura PEP_PPM_QUERY_FEEDBACK_COUNTERS describe todos los contadores de rendimiento del procesador que admite el complemento de extensión de plataforma (PEP) para un procesador determinado.

Sintaxis

C++
typedef struct _PEP_PPM_QUERY_FEEDBACK_COUNTERS {
  [in]  ULONG                          Count;
        PEP_PROCESSOR_FEEDBACK_COUNTER Counters[ANYSIZE_ARRAY];
} PEP_PPM_QUERY_FEEDBACK_COUNTERS, *PPEP_PPM_QUERY_FEEDBACK_COUNTERS;

Miembros

[in] Count

Número de contadores de comentarios de rendimiento del procesador admitidos por el PEP. El PEP proporcionó anteriormente este recuento en respuesta a una notificación de PEP_NOTIFY_PPM_QUERY_CAPABILITIES.

[out] Counters[ANYSIZE_ARRAY]

Primer elemento de una matriz de estructuras PEP_PROCESSOR_FEEDBACK_COUNTER. Si esta matriz contiene más de un elemento, los elementos adicionales siguen inmediatamente el final de la estructura PEP_PPM_QUERY_FEEDBACK_COUNTERS. El miembro Count especifica el número de elementos de esta matriz. Para obtener más información, vea Comentarios.

Observaciones

La notificación de PEP_NOTIFY_PPM_QUERY_FEEDBACK_COUNTERS usa esta estructura. El miembro Count de la estructura contiene un valor de entrada que PoFx proporciona cuando se envía esta notificación. El miembro counters contiene un valor de salida que el PEP escribe en respuesta a la notificación. El PEP escribe los elementos de matriz adicionales contadores en el área de búfer de salida que sigue a la estructura de PEP_PPM_QUERY_FEEDBACK_COUNTERS. Se garantiza que el búfer asignado a PoFx para esta estructura sea lo suficientemente grande como para contener cualquier elemento de matriz que siga la estructura.

Requisitos

Requisito Valor
cliente mínimo admitido Se admite a partir de Windows 10.
encabezado de pepfx.h (include Pep_x.h, Pep_x.h)

Consulte también

PEP_NOTIFY_PPM_QUERY_FEEDBACK_COUNTERS

PEP_PROCESSOR_FEEDBACK_COUNTER